darshith Ответов: 2

примерный вид сетки в asp.net с#


<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
    <title>Untitled Page</title>
</head>
<body>
    <form id="form1" runat="server">
    <div>



        <asp:GridView ID="GridView1" runat="server">

        </asp:GridView>



    </div>
    </form>
</body>
</html>




с#




использование системы;
использование системы.Конфигурация;
использование System.Data;
использование System.Linq;
использование системы.Сеть;
использование System.Web.Security;
использование System.Web.UI;
используя системы.Веб.Пользовательского интерфейса.HtmlControls;
используя системы.Веб.Пользовательского интерфейса.WebControls;
используя системы.Веб.Пользовательского интерфейса.WebControls.элемент webPart;
используя системы.В формате XML.В LINQ;
используя системы.Данных.Поставщики sqlclient;


общественный разделяемого класса _default : на системы.Веб.Пользовательского интерфейса.Страницы
{


охраняемых недействительными в(объект отправителя, EventArgs в электронной)
{
строки strSQLconnection = (@"источник данных=.;Начальный каталог=новый;Комплексная безопасность=истина");

Объект sqlconnection объект sqlconnection = новое sqlconnection(strSQLconnection);

Sqlcommand объект sqlcommand, который = новая команда sqlcommand("Select * из людей", объект sqlconnection);

объект sqlconnection.Открыть();



SqlDataReader reader = sqlCommand.Метода executereader();



Управления gridview1.Источник данных = читатель;

Управления gridview1.Привязку();

}


}

Abhijit Parab

Чего ты хочешь? с какой проблемой вы столкнулись?

Rickin Kane

он показывает свою способность gridview databind :)

Samer Aburabie

ло0о0ол .. Я думаю, что так оно и есть :)

Rickin Kane

позвольте мне завершить ваш вопрос , я пытаюсь привязать запись из таблицы Person , но когда моя загрузка страницы заканчивается , мой gridview пуст , где я иду неправильно

Tejas Vaishnav

Одна вещь, прежде чем задавать такой вопрос, пожалуйста, попробуйте поискать в google, чтобы выяснить вашу проблему. и есть смысл задать вопрос надлежащим образом, чтобы другие могли понять, что вы хотите спросить.

2 Ответов

Рейтинг:
12

Tejas Vaishnav

Попробуйте этот код, если он решит вашу проблему
или обратитесь по этой ссылке Демо-версия GridView Databinging[^]

string strSQLconnection = (@"Data Source=.;Initial Catalog=new;Integrated Security=True");
SqlConnection sqlConnection = new SqlConnection(strSQLconnection);
SqlCommand sqlCommand = new SqlCommand("select * from persons", sqlConnection);
sqlConnection.Open();
SqlDataAdapter sqlDa = new SqlDataAdapter(sqlCommand);
DataTable dt = new DataTable();
sqlDa.Fill(dt);
sqlConnection.Close();
GridView1.DataSource = dt;
GridView1.DataBind();


ОПЕРАЦИОННАЯ
string strSQLconnection = (@"Data Source=.;Initial Catalog=new;Integrated Security=True");
SqlConnection sqlConnection = new SqlConnection(strSQLconnection);
sqlConnection.Open();
SqlDataAdapter sqlDa = new SqlDataAdapter();
sqlDa.SelectCommand.Connection = sqlConnection;
sqlDa.SelectCommand.CommandType = CommandType.Text;
sqlDa.SelectCommand.CommandText = "YOUR SELECT QUERY";
DataTable dt = new DataTable();
sqlDa.Fill(dt);
sqlConnection.Close();
GridView1.DataSource = dt;
GridView1.DataBind();


Рейтинг:
0

erictrarner

Этот учебник помог мне создать gridview

Asp.Net учебник по Gridview

Эрик